What is Westlake's housing products — revenue?
Westlake (WLK) reported housing products — revenue of $788M in Q1 2026.
How has Westlake's housing products — revenue changed year-over-year?
Westlake's housing products — revenue decreased by 6.0% year-over-year, from $838M to $788M.
What is the long-term trend for Westlake's housing products — revenue?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Westlake's housing products — revenue has grown at a 10.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$2.33B to $3.51B.
